Understanding Bad Breath: Causes and Considerations
Before delving into supplements, it is crucial to grasp what causes bad breath. The primary culprit is bacteria in the mouth that produce sulfur compounds during the breakdown of food particles. This bacterial activity can be exacerbated by poor oral hygiene, gum disease, dry mouth, certain medications, and specific foods like garlic or onions.

Factors such as smoking and diet also play significant roles. For instance, dieters may experience bad breath due to ketosis — a metabolic state that occurs when the body burns fat for fuel instead of carbohydrates. Additionally, underlying medical conditions like sinus infections or gastrointestinal issues can contribute to halitosis.

Probiotics: A Closer Look
Among the various supplements available, oral probiotics have gained attention for their potential benefits in managing bad breath. These beneficial bacteria may help restore balance within the oral microbiome by suppressing harmful bacteria growth. Research indicates that strains such as Lactobacillus reuteri may reduce volatile sulfur compounds—common offenders in causing halitosis.
However, it's essential to evaluate probiotic efficacy based on clinical studies rather than anecdotal evidence alone. Consulting with healthcare professionals before incorporating these into your routine can provide tailored advice based on individual needs.

Traditional Remedies vs Supplements
While exploring the world of supplements is appealing, traditional methods remain fundamental in combating bad breath:
- Daily Brushing and Flossing: These practices remove food particles and plaque buildup that harbor odor-causing bacteria. Regular Dental Check-Ups: Professional cleanings help eliminate tartar buildup and address any underlying dental issues. Hydration: Staying well-hydrated combats dry mouth—a significant contributor to halitosis. Dietary Choices: Incorporating crunchy fruits and vegetables like apples or carrots can naturally cleanse teeth while promoting salivation.
